Exploring Chichen Itza

One of the most famous day trips from Moon Palace Cancun is the Chichen Itza Classic + Cenote + Valladolid tour. This full-day excursion takes around 12 hours and is priced from $74. It features a comprehensive tour of the ancient Mayan ruins, a refreshing swim in a cenote, and a visit to the charming colonial town of Valladolid. While the tour is rated 3.9, it's a must for history buffs. Be prepared for a long day, as the drive from the hotel is about two hours each way. The best days for this trip are weekdays when crowds are lower.

Adventure at Xcaret Park

Xcaret Park offers a full day of activities, including snorkeling, cultural shows, and wildlife encounters. This all-inclusive experience lasts about 15 hours and costs around $185, with a high rating of 4.87. The drive from Moon Palace Cancun is approximately 30 minutes, making it a convenient option. The park is open daily, but weekends can be busier, so consider visiting mid-week for a more relaxed experience. This trip is perfect for families looking for a mix of entertainment and education.

Cenote and Turtle Swimming Tours

For nature lovers, the Cenotes and Akumal Day Tour with Turtle Swimming is an excellent choice. Priced at $89 and rated 5, this tour lasts about 8 hours and includes opportunities to swim with sea turtles in their natural habitat. The drive to Akumal from Moon Palace Cancun takes around 30 minutes. This trip is best suited for sunny days, as swimming is the main highlight. It is advisable to book this tour in advance during the peak season to secure your spot, as it can be quite popular.

Isla Mujeres Excursions

The Isla Mujeres Catamaran Tour is another fantastic day trip option, providing a full day of fun on the water. This tour lasts around 12 hours and costs approximately $49, rated 4.33. The catamaran ride includes snorkeling and a buffet, making it ideal for groups. The boat departs from Cancun, and the trip takes about 30 minutes each way. To get the most out of this excursion, consider booking on a weekday to avoid the larger crowds typically seen on weekends.
